I did not include jobs/work experience that were not related to my artistic career on my CV. I did include workshop I participated in as a small section labeled professional development and any podcasts I was featured in as a section called media on my CV.

My CV was 2 pages. My solicitor recommended to keep it between 1-2 pages.

That should be fine to include one piece of work in two different pieces of evidence. As long as you fulfill the necessary requirement for proof of appearances and the requirements for an eligible award it should be grand.

I used one performance as proof of appearance and media recognition. For proof of appearances I included links to the show url as well as copies of the programme. I used a critical review of the performance as media recognition.

No I didn’t include the authors bio or CV in the support letter that I included with my piece of evidence. I made sure that they included their title (director, producer, etc.), their contact number, email and full address of the company they worked for & company number.

That’s a great question! I included the letter of support for my evidence as an additional document within the PDF. This meant that a piece of evidence which included a letter of support was 3 pages in total.

When I submitted my application I also included a PDF cover letter which included a table of contents that numbered each piece of evidence and noted if it included a letter of support.

The current guidelines (as of February 2025) have different requirements for their critics depending on whether you're applying for exceptional talent or exceptional promise.

Exceptional Talent states: 'The evidence must be in the form of detailed independent critiques, reviews or critical evaluations of your individual work, from credible arts and culture critics in internationally recognised and well-established media outlets...'

Exception Promise states: 'The evidence must be in the form of detailed independent reviews, critiques or critical evaluations of your individual work from credible critics in established media outlets...'

Please note that these are the requirements as of February 2025; it's always best to consult the most updated version of the ACE guidelines in case they change or are updated in the future.

I applied as exceptional promise, so I chose to use reviews written by critics with a track record of writing reviews for other performances.

I didn't find that ACE had specific expectations for how the evidence should be formatted or presented. I used the guidelines available from Arts Council England and followed them closely (you can download the current guide from the link provided). Since ACE doesn't give examples of evidence, it is flexible for how you choose to present your evidence. Personally, I made sure to number each piece of evidence and grouped them by category. I included a header on each piece of evidence with my information and visa route I was applying for. If you have any letters of support from the director / producer be sure to include that with the evidence--the letter won't make you go over the 2 page A4 limit.

When submitting my entire application via email, I also included a short cover letter which included a breakdown of each piece of evidence I was submitting.

Within the application form for Stage 1, you will also have to outline what evidence you are including and also fill in a short biography of each of your letter writers. Be sure to prepare that in advance as well. I think it was like 500 characters per author.
